Bucks County has a predicted average indoor radon screening level greater than 4 pCi/L (pico curies per liter) - Highest Potential
Air Quality Index (AQI) level in 2010 was 32.5. This is about average.
Ozone [ppb] level in 2010 was 24.3. This is about average. Closest monitor was 18.9 miles away from the city center.
Nitrogen Dioxide (NO2) [ppb] level in 2010 was 10.9. This is about average. Closest monitor was 18.9 miles away from the city center.
Particulate Matter (PM10) [µ/m3] level in 2010 was 15.6. This is significantly better than average. Closest monitor was 18.9 miles away from the city center.
Particulate Matter (PM2.5) [µ/m3] level in 2010 was 9.93. This is about average. Closest monitor was 18.8 miles away from the city center.
Carbon Monoxide (CO) [ppm] level in 2010 was 0.369. This is about average. Closest monitor was 18.9 miles away from the city center.
Sulfur Dioxide (SO2) [ppb] level in 2010 was 4.03. This is significantly worse than average. Closest monitor was 18.9 miles away from the city center.
Lead (Pb) [µ/m3] level in 2007 was 0.00616. This is significantly better than average. Closest monitor was 16.5 miles away from the city center.
Drinking water stations with addresses in Dublin and their reported violations in the past:
BOROUGH OF DUBLIN (Population served: 1778, Groundwater):
Past monitoring violations:
- CCR INADEQUATE REPORTING - Between OCT-2004 and JAN-2005,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: St Compliance achieved (JAN-31-2005), St Consent Decree/Judgement (JAN-31-2005), St Formal NOV issued (JAN-31-2005)
- CCR Complete Failure to Report - Between JUL-01-2000 and JUL-14-2000,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: Fed Compliance achieved (JUL-14-2000)
- 21 regular monitoring violations
DUBLIN ACRES HOMEOWNERS ASSOC. (Population served: 175, Groundwater):
Past monitoring violations:
- PN Violation for NPDWR Violation - Between FEB-11-2006 and JUN-23-2006, Contaminant: Public Notice. Follow-up actions: St Compliance achieved (JUN-23-2006), St Consent Decree/Judgement (JUN-23-2006)
- Monitoring and Reporting Stage 1 - Between APR-2005 and JUN-2005, Contaminant: Chlorine. Follow-up actions: St Compliance achieved (FEB-09-2006), St Consent Decree/Judgement (FEB-09-2006)
- Monitoring and Reporting Stage 1 - Between JUL-2004 and SEP-2004, Contaminant: Chlorine. Follow-up actions: St Violation/Reminder Notice (OCT-15-2004), St Compliance achieved (OCT-15-2004)
- CCR Complete Failure to Report - Between JUL-01-2000 and AUG-07-2000,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: Fed Compliance achieved (AUG-07-2000)
- CCR Complete Failure to Report - Between OCT-19-1999 and MAR-13-2000,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: Fed Formal NOV issued (JAN-27-2000), Fed Compliance achieved (MAR-13-2000)
- 5 routine major monitoring violations
- 21 regular monitoring violations
- 2 other older monitoring violations
BUCKS RUN APARTMENTS (Population served: 120, Groundwater):
Past monitoring violations:
- Monitoring and Reporting Stage 1 - Between JUL-2004 and SEP-2004, Contaminant: Total Haloacetic Acids (HAA5). Follow-up actions: St Public Notif requested (JAN-11-2005), St Violation/Reminder Notice (JAN-11-2005), St Public Notif received (JAN-31-2006), St Compliance achieved (JAN-31-2006)
- Monitoring and Reporting Stage 1 - Between JUL-2004 and SEP-2004, Contaminant: TTHM. Follow-up actions: St Public Notif requested (JAN-11-2005), St Violation/Reminder Notice (JAN-11-2005), St Public Notif received (JAN-31-2006), St Compliance achieved (JAN-31-2006)
- CCR INADEQUATE REPORTING - Between OCT-2003 and JAN-2004,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: St Compliance achieved (JAN-27-2004)
- CCR Complete Failure to Report - Between JUL-01-2002 and AUG-02-2002,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: Fed Compliance achieved (AUG-02-2002)
- CCR Complete Failure to Report - Between JUL-01-2001 and NOV-02-2001,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: Fed Formal NOV issued (OCT-15-2001), Fed Compliance achieved (NOV-02-2001)
- 13 regular monitoring violations
- 2 other older monitoring violations

Banks with branches in Dublin (2011 data):
- QNB Bank: Dublin Village Branch at 161 North Main Street, branch established on 1981/10/24. Info updated 2008/02/06: Bank assets: $864.8 mil, Deposits: $750.7 mil, headquarters in Quakertown, PA, positive income, Commercial Lending Specialization, 11 total offices, Holding Company: Qnb Corp.
- First Savings Bank of Perkasie: 142 N Main Street Branch at 142 N Main Street, branch established on 1922/01/01. Info updated 2008/02/06: Bank assets: $1,007.0 mil, Deposits: $683.8 mil, headquarters in Perkasie, PA, negative income in the last year, Commercial Lending Specialization, 12 total offices, Holding Company: Fsb Mutual Holdings, Inc.

Most commonly used house heating fuel:
- Electricity (67%)
- Fuel oil, kerosene, etc. (26%)
- Bottled, tank, or LP gas (5%)
- Utility gas (1%)
- Wood (1%)
- No fuel used (1%)
